From b5dd45dc07b82cd48ac0ae8ac68ee41c391ea826 Mon Sep 17 00:00:00 2001 From: noeffn Date: Fri, 2 Sep 2022 19:47:50 +0200 Subject: [PATCH] [boost-modular-build-helper] Add BSD and FreeBSD target-os (#26562) * [boost-modular-build-helper] Add BSD and FreeBSD target-os [boost-modular-build-helper] Updates port version * [boost-modular-build-helper] Use CMAKE_SYSTEM_NAME to detect freebsd * [boost-modular-build-helper] Use port-version 1 * update evrsion * [boost-modular_build-helper ] Use VCPKG_DETECTED_CMAKE_SYSTEM_NAME for FreeBSD detection * [boost-modular-build-helper] Updates version * Update boost-modular-build-helper.json Co-authored-by: Avezy Co-authored-by: Jonliu1993 <13720414433@163.com> --- ports/boost-modular-build-helper/CMakeLists.txt | 2 ++ ports/boost-modular-build-helper/vcpkg.json | 1 + versions/b-/boost-modular-build-helper.json | 5 +++++ versions/baseline.json | 2 +- 4 files changed, 9 insertions(+), 1 deletion(-) diff --git a/ports/boost-modular-build-helper/CMakeLists.txt b/ports/boost-modular-build-helper/CMakeLists.txt index 6549f43cd63..a222f165c17 100644 --- a/ports/boost-modular-build-helper/CMakeLists.txt +++ b/ports/boost-modular-build-helper/CMakeLists.txt @@ -79,6 +79,8 @@ elseif(APPLE) endif() elseif(ANDROID) list(APPEND B2_OPTIONS target-os=android) +elseif(VCPKG_DETECTED_CMAKE_SYSTEM_NAME STREQUAL "FreeBSD") + list(APPEND B2_OPTIONS target-os=freebsd) else() list(APPEND B2_OPTIONS target-os=linux) endif() diff --git a/ports/boost-modular-build-helper/vcpkg.json b/ports/boost-modular-build-helper/vcpkg.json index 9220b8553aa..8b1db10f69e 100644 --- a/ports/boost-modular-build-helper/vcpkg.json +++ b/ports/boost-modular-build-helper/vcpkg.json @@ -1,6 +1,7 @@ { "name": "boost-modular-build-helper", "version": "1.80.0", + "port-version": 1, "description": "Internal vcpkg port used to build Boost libraries", "license": "MIT", "dependencies": [ diff --git a/versions/b-/boost-modular-build-helper.json b/versions/b-/boost-modular-build-helper.json index a2b7b55b706..1ca49578535 100644 --- a/versions/b-/boost-modular-build-helper.json +++ b/versions/b-/boost-modular-build-helper.json @@ -1,5 +1,10 @@ { "versions": [ + { + "git-tree": "3cfe5562e40b1ef219b3d36054e1235508c41037", + "version": "1.80.0", + "port-version": 1 + }, { "git-tree": "3047d0e2fdc4eee0c918f418f45d5e1dfb86c0fb", "version": "1.80.0", diff --git a/versions/baseline.json b/versions/baseline.json index 86325ac1043..c2ff16fb38f 100644 --- a/versions/baseline.json +++ b/versions/baseline.json @@ -846,7 +846,7 @@ }, "boost-modular-build-helper": { "baseline": "1.80.0", - "port-version": 0 + "port-version": 1 }, "boost-move": { "baseline": "1.80.0",